2005 Audi A4 vs. 2005 Toyota Avensis
To start off, both 2005 Audi A4 and 2005 Toyota Avensis were released in the same year (2005).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,496 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Audi A4 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Toyota Avensis (175 HP) has 14 more horse power than 2005 Audi A4. (161 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Toyota Avensis should accelerate faster than 2005 Audi A4.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Toyota Avensis (400 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 50 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Audi A4. (350 Nm @ 1500 RPM). This means 2005 Toyota Avensis will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Audi A4.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Audi A4 | 2005 Toyota Avensis | |
Make | Audi | Toyota |
Model | A4 | Avensis |
Year Released | 2005 | 2005 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2496 cc | 2199 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 161 HP | 175 HP |
Torque | 350 Nm | 400 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1500 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 78.4 mm | 86.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86.4 mm | 96 mm |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Diesel |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4550 mm | 4640 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1490 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2710 mm |
